Typically found on birch trees across the northern hemisphere, in colder climates, the Chaga Mushroom (Inonotus Obliquus), is a powerful mushroom, renowned for its antioxidant, and immune boosting properties. Chaga has been used as a herbal medicine across europe and asia for centuries, and is usually consumed as a tea, but is also used to make a healthier coffee alternative. Chaga Powder is abundant with Beta-D-Glucans, which helps to boost the immune system and stabilize it when it is overactive. On top of this, Chaga is extremely high in antioxidant, and is in the top 10 of the ORAC scale, which measure the antioxidant properties of foods and beverages. To make a Chaga tea, simple add half a teaspoon of chaga powder to a cup, and mix with hot water, stir and leave to brew for a few minutes, before straining. You can also add either syrup or honey to sweeten the drink.
